Understanding RAM and Its Role

RAM is your laptop’s short-term memory. It’s where your computer stores the data it’s actively using. Think of it as the workspace on your desk. The larger the desk, the more documents and tools you can have readily available, allowing you to work faster and more efficiently.

When you open an application, browse the web, or edit a photo, the necessary data is loaded from your hard drive (or SSD) into RAM. The more RAM you have, the more applications and data your laptop can handle simultaneously without slowing down.

Insufficient RAM can lead to several frustrating issues, including sluggish performance, frequent freezing, and error messages. Your laptop may start using the hard drive as virtual memory, which is significantly slower than RAM. This can cause a noticeable lag, especially when running multiple programs or working with large files.

Factors to Consider Before Upgrading

While upgrading RAM can offer numerous benefits, it’s essential to consider several factors before making a purchase. Not all laptops are suitable for RAM upgrades, and sometimes the bottleneck lies elsewhere.

Laptop Compatibility

The most crucial factor to consider is whether your laptop even allows for RAM upgrades. Some laptops, especially ultra-thin models, have RAM soldered directly onto the motherboard, making it impossible to upgrade.

Check your laptop’s specifications or consult the manufacturer’s website to determine if the RAM is upgradable. You can also use tools like Crucial’s Memory Advisor to identify compatible RAM modules for your specific laptop model.

Maximum RAM Capacity

Even if your laptop supports RAM upgrades, it will have a maximum RAM capacity. This is the maximum amount of RAM that the laptop’s motherboard can support. Exceeding this limit will not improve performance and may even cause instability.

Again, consult your laptop’s specifications or the manufacturer’s website to determine the maximum RAM capacity.

RAM Type and Speed

It’s crucial to choose the correct type and speed of RAM for your laptop. The most common types of RAM used in laptops are DDR3, DDR4, and DDR5. Each type has a different pin configuration and is not interchangeable.

You also need to consider the RAM speed, measured in MHz. Your laptop’s motherboard will have a maximum supported RAM speed. Installing faster RAM than what’s supported will not improve performance, as the RAM will simply run at the slower supported speed.

Operating System Limitations

Your operating system can also impose limitations on the amount of RAM that can be utilized. 32-bit versions of Windows, for example, can only address a maximum of 4GB of RAM.

If you want to use more than 4GB of RAM, you’ll need to upgrade to a 64-bit version of Windows or another operating system that supports larger memory addresses.

How Much RAM Do You Need?

Determining the right amount of RAM for your laptop depends on your usage patterns and the types of applications you typically run. Here’s a general guideline:

4GB of RAM

4GB of RAM is the bare minimum for basic tasks like web browsing, email, and word processing. However, it’s likely to feel sluggish when running multiple applications or working with large files. This is generally only suitable for very light use.

8GB of RAM

8GB of RAM is a good starting point for most users. It’s sufficient for everyday tasks like web browsing, email, word processing, and light gaming. You’ll be able to run multiple applications simultaneously without experiencing significant performance issues.

16GB of RAM

16GB of RAM is recommended for users who frequently multitask, work with resource-intensive applications like video editing software or graphic design tools, or play demanding games. It provides a comfortable amount of headroom and ensures smooth performance even under heavy workloads.

32GB of RAM or More

32GB of RAM or more is typically only needed for professionals who work with extremely large files, run virtual machines, or engage in other highly demanding tasks. For most users, 16GB is more than sufficient.

Step-by-Step Guide to Upgrading Laptop RAM

If you’ve determined that upgrading your laptop’s RAM is the right move, here’s a step-by-step guide to the process:

Step 1: Identify Compatible RAM

Use Crucial’s Memory Advisor or consult your laptop’s specifications to identify compatible RAM modules. Make sure to choose the correct type, speed, and capacity.

Step 2: Gather Your Tools

You’ll need a small Phillips head screwdriver, an anti-static wrist strap, and a clean, well-lit workspace.

Step 3: Power Down and Disconnect

Turn off your laptop completely and disconnect the power adapter and any other peripherals.

Step 4: Ground Yourself

Attach the anti-static wrist strap to your wrist and clip the other end to a metal part of your laptop chassis to prevent electrostatic discharge from damaging the components.

Step 5: Access the RAM Compartment

The location of the RAM compartment varies depending on the laptop model. In some cases, you’ll need to remove the entire bottom panel. In others, there’s a dedicated access panel for the RAM. Consult your laptop’s manual for instructions.

Step 6: Remove Existing RAM (If Applicable)

If you’re replacing existing RAM modules, carefully release the clips on either side of the RAM slots and gently pull the modules out.

Step 7: Install New RAM Modules

Align the notch on the RAM module with the notch on the RAM slot. Press down firmly on both ends of the module until the clips click into place.

Step 8: Reassemble and Test

Reassemble the laptop, reconnect the power adapter, and turn it on. Check your system information to confirm that the new RAM is recognized. Run some tests to ensure that the RAM is working correctly.

When Upgrading RAM Might Not Be the Answer

Sometimes, adding more RAM isn’t the solution to your performance woes. It’s crucial to identify the bottleneck accurately before investing in an upgrade. Here are some situations where a RAM upgrade might not be the most effective approach:

Slow Hard Drive

If your laptop is still using a traditional hard drive (HDD), upgrading to a solid-state drive (SSD) will likely provide a more significant performance boost than upgrading RAM. HDDs are significantly slower than SSDs, and they can become a major bottleneck, especially when loading applications or accessing files.

Outdated CPU

If your laptop has an older, less powerful CPU, it may be the limiting factor in its performance. In this case, upgrading RAM may not provide a noticeable improvement, as the CPU will still struggle to keep up with demanding tasks.

Graphics Card Limitations

If you’re experiencing performance issues in games or when working with graphics-intensive applications, the problem may be with your graphics card. Upgrading RAM won’t improve graphics performance if your graphics card is the bottleneck.

Software Issues

Sometimes, performance issues are caused by software problems, such as malware infections, driver conflicts, or bloated operating systems. In these cases, upgrading RAM won’t solve the underlying problem.

Laptop is too old

If the laptop is very old, adding RAM might help but other components will also be outdated. The performance gain may not be significant enough to justify the cost. It might be time to consider a new laptop.

How do I determine if my laptop needs more RAM?

The easiest way to determine if your laptop needs more RAM is to monitor its memory usage while performing your typical tasks. On Windows, you can use the Task Manager (Ctrl+Shift+Esc) to view RAM usage under the “Performance” tab. On macOS, you can use the Activity Monitor (located in Applications/Utilities) to check memory pressure. If your RAM usage consistently hovers near 80% or higher, it’s a strong indication that you could benefit from an upgrade.

Another telltale sign is experiencing slowdowns, freezes, or frequent disk activity even when running relatively simple programs. If your laptop feels sluggish despite having enough processing power, insufficient RAM is a likely culprit. Additionally, encountering error messages related to low memory or programs crashing unexpectedly can also point to a need for more RAM.

What type of RAM is compatible with my laptop?

Finding the correct type of RAM is crucial to ensure compatibility and proper functionality. The most important factors to consider are the RAM generation (DDR3, DDR4, DDR5), the RAM speed (measured in MHz), and the physical form factor (SODIMM for laptops). Refer to your laptop’s manual or the manufacturer’s website to determine the exact RAM specifications required for your model.

You can also use online tools like Crucial’s Memory Advisor or Kingston’s Memory Search to identify compatible RAM modules based on your laptop’s make and model. These tools typically provide detailed information about the RAM type, speed, and maximum capacity supported by your system. Mixing different types of RAM can lead to instability and performance issues, so it’s best to stick to the recommended specifications.

Is it difficult to install RAM in a laptop?

Installing RAM in a laptop is generally a straightforward process, but it can vary depending on the laptop model. Most laptops have easy-access panels on the bottom that allow you to access the RAM slots. However, some laptops require more extensive disassembly, which can be more challenging and may void your warranty if not done correctly.

Before you begin, always disconnect the power adapter and remove the battery (if possible) to prevent electrical shock. Consult your laptop’s manual or watch a tutorial video to familiarize yourself with the specific steps for your model. Take your time and handle the RAM modules carefully to avoid damaging them or the laptop’s components.

How much does it cost to add RAM to a laptop?

The cost of adding RAM to a laptop varies depending on several factors, including the amount of RAM, the type of RAM (DDR3, DDR4, DDR5), the RAM speed, and the brand. Generally, you can expect to pay anywhere from $30 to $150 or more for a RAM upgrade. Lower capacity modules (e.g., 4GB or 8GB) and older RAM types (e.g., DDR3) tend to be less expensive than higher capacity modules (e.g., 16GB or 32GB) and newer RAM types (e.g., DDR5).

Keep an eye out for sales and discounts, as RAM prices can fluctuate. Also, consider the cost of professional installation if you’re not comfortable installing the RAM yourself. While DIY installation can save you money, it’s important to weigh the risks of damaging your laptop if you’re not experienced.
